Rice Stuffed chicken<br />
Breasts<br />
Serves 4<br />
4 boneless chicken<br />
breasts<br />
% teaspoon pepper<br />
salt to taste<br />
1 cup cooked white rice<br />
!4 CUP diced tomato<br />
!4 CUP grated Mozzarella cheese<br />
1 Tablespoon basil<br />
cooking oil<br />
Directions:<br />
Cut the chicken breasts in half. Pound each one<br />
with a mallet until $4 inch thick. Season the chicken<br />
with the pepper and salt.<br />
In a mixing bowl, combine the white rice,<br />
tomatoes, Mozzarella cheese, and basil. Toss all of the<br />
ingredients until well blended. Spoon an even amount<br />
of the rice mixture on top of each chicken breast. Fold<br />
and secure with string and toothpicks. In a skillet heat<br />
enough oil to coat the bottom of the pan. Brown the<br />
chicken on both sides for 1 minute or until golden.<br />
Remove from the skillet and place in the<br />
bottom of a baking dish. Bake at 350' F for 10-15<br />
minutes.<br />

Some <strong>Montana</strong> DU Facts!<br />
* <strong>Montana</strong> ranks 3rd in the Nation for Waterfowl<br />
Production, only behind North and South Dakota!<br />
* In 201 0 <strong>Montana</strong> "grassroots" raised over $494,000<br />
net dollars for wetland conservation!<br />
* 86% of <strong>Ducks</strong> <strong>Unlimited</strong> support and revenue goes<br />
directly "on the ground" to habitat conservation. 2%<br />
goes to staff budget!<br />
* In 20 10 <strong>Ducks</strong> <strong>Unlimited</strong> has protected, restored,<br />
enhanced, and developed over 4,000 acres on 8 project<br />
sites in <strong>Montana</strong>!<br />

Waterfowl hunting opportunities are abundant<br />
here in NE <strong>Montana</strong> and Duck <strong>Unlimited</strong> has played a<br />
huge role in helping create the habitat, and waterfowl<br />
numbers.<br />
<strong>Ducks</strong> <strong>Unlimited</strong>'s #1 conservation focus areathe<br />
Prairie Pothole Region- provides North America<br />
with more than 75% of our waterfowl population and<br />
most of Northern <strong>Montana</strong> is in this Region.<br />
While DU 7 s priority is waterfowl, more than<br />
900 wildlife species benefit from Du 7 s conservation<br />
work in fact more than 12 million acres of waterfowl<br />
habitat in North America, which is more than any other<br />
conservation organization in existence.<br />
There's no denying that <strong>Ducks</strong> <strong>Unlimited</strong> cares<br />
for wildlife, waterfowl hunters and their heritage. DU's<br />
vital habitat work has a positive impact on waterfowl<br />
populations and helps guarantee the resource for future<br />
generations. Last year alone DU 7 s grassroots dollars<br />
raised over $494,000 dollars with over 86% of those<br />
dollars raised by DU was dedicated towards conservation<br />
efforts. Yes those are National numbers but for every<br />
$1 that the <strong>Montana</strong> <strong>Ducks</strong> <strong>Unlimited</strong> chapters sends<br />
to the National DU we receive $3 in return to be spent<br />
on <strong>Montana</strong> wetland conservation! I would say that's<br />
money well spent.<br />
Duck <strong>Unlimited</strong> is the world's largest<br />
nonprofit organization dedicated to conserving North<br />
America's continually disappearing waterfowl habitats.<br />
Established in 1937, DU has conserved more than 12<br />
million acres thanks to contributions from more than<br />
a million supporters across the continent. Guided by<br />
science and dedicated to program efficiency, DU works<br />
toward the vision of wetlands sufficient to fill the skies<br />
with waterfowl today, tomorrow and forever.<br />
